IP查询
查询
你查询的IP:[114.60.240.100] 地理位置:中国–上海–上海东方有线
最新查询
61.232.177.171
203.196.76.191
210.72.183.157
124.64.156.180
59.151.212.140
123.137.227.51
119.32.76.3
122.112.120.53
119.20.140.189
114.60.240.100
120.24.24.189
123.8.43.143
202.180.128.225
120.24.217.153
202.122.64.14
121.192.247.47
123.112.180.13
119.40.64.90
59.191.240.209
122.112.56.70
124.88.119.59
203.192.3.31
118.91.240.211
124.64.198.129
117.80.144.191
203.187.160.225
116.70.155.224
202.14.238.145
203.222.192.140
203.93.223.24
222.192.77.98